Overview

Mody University of Science and Technology, formerly known as Mody Institute, is a private women's university located in Lakshmangarh, in the state of Rajasthan, India. The institution caters exclusively to women students and offers programmes in fields associated with science and technology.

The university was established in 1998 by R. P. Mody, an industrialist and philanthropist. It was founded with the aim of providing higher education opportunities to women in a residential university setting.

Situated in the Sikar district of Rajasthan, the university operates as a women-only institution and forms part of the network of private universities in the state.
